Output e18a038972aa96b50535510a9fb0fc159d9bbed54b9cf3e0a644fd2515031a2b: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f861f7229c37035ec8063b8515985da7820fd15d OP_EQUAL
address
3QLLrsUWuwkearJTk371JQ3mw96BaUYV4D
transaction
e18a038972aa96b50535510a9fb0fc159d9bbed54b9cf3e0a644fd2515031a2b
spent
true